Jumat, 08 Mei 2015

Session 3

File System


File system adalah sebuah file yang berfungsi untuk mengorganisirdan memanage file akses ke data. Biasanya dalam file system terdapat meta data yang disematkan, seperti:
-          Owner and group information
-          Time
-          Permission

File system yang umum adalah sebagai berikut:
-           UFS
-          HSFS
-          EXT2
-          FAT32
-          NTFS
-          HFS+

Yang diatas ini adalah file system yang umumnya di Windows, sedangkan di Unix berbeda. Sebagai berikut.

Absolute path name adalah tempat yang sudah pasti di suatu lokasi. Misalnya: cd /var/bin/etc. lokasi directory dari etc adalah sudah pasti dalam bin, bin dalam var, seperti itu.

Jenis-jenis file types
-          Regular files
-          Directories
-          Link (shortcut)
-          Special files
-          Named pipes dan unnamed pipes

Special File.  Adalah file khusus yang tidak boleh di pakai penamaannya. Semua file itu ada arti dan fungsi khususnya. Jadi tidak bisa sembarangan di buat. Seperti, nul, con, prn.

Softlink & Hardlink
Kalau hardlink, saat satu file ke delete yang lain ikut ke delete sedangkan softlink, bisa di tempat  lain.

File Operation
Berikut adalah file operation.
-          Create
-          Delete
-          Open
-          Close
-          Read
-          Write
-          Append
-          Seek
-          Get attributes
-          Set attributes
-          Rename



Directory Operation
Berikut adalah directory operation.

-          Create
-          Delete
-          Opendir
-          Closedir
-          Readdir
-          Rename
-          Link
-     Unlink


"File system ibarat seperti akte kelahiran mungkin"

Tidak ada komentar:

Posting Komentar